Jackpot Winner: $260K Lottery Ticket Bought At CT Gas Station One lucky person claimed a more than $260,000 jackpot after buying a lottery ticket at a gas station in Storrs.  The $264,552 Fast Play EXTREME GREEN $10 ticket was sold on Saturday, Jan. 28 in Tolland County at the Mobil Xtra Mart located at 2103 Storrs Rd., Connecticut Lottery announced.  The lucky winner took home 100 percent of the jackpot.  Connecticut Lottery did not reveal any details about who bought the winning ticket.

Lane Closures: Sprain Brook Parkway In Mount Pleasant To Be Affected Multiple Days Traffic on a major parkway in Northern Westchester will soon be affected by lane closures that will last for multiple days.  Beginning on Wednesday, Feb. 1, two lanes along the northbound Sprain Brook Parkway in Mount Pleasant between State Route 100 and the Taconic State Parkway will close, Department of Transportation officials said.  The lanes will be closed between 10:30 a.m. and 2:30 p.m. through Friday, Feb. 3.  The closure is to facilitate drainage work.

Fight At Local Shop Leads To Stabbing In Hudson Valley, Suspect In Custody: Police A man is facing charges after stabbing a victim twice in a fight inside a Hudson Valley business, police said.  The altercation broke out on Monday, Jan. 30 around 10 p.m., in Putnam County at the Cloud House Smoke Shop located in Carmel at 898 Route 6. There, police found a 22-year-old man outside the store heavily bleeding from two stab wounds, Carmel Police said.  Authorities realized that a fight had broken out inside the store, resulting in the victim being stabbed in the chest and back. The victim was rushed to Danbury Hospital in critical but stable condition, police said.…

Duo Charged In 2 Separate Shootings In Yonkers: Police Two men have been charged in relation to two separate shootings that left multiple people with gunshot wounds, police said.  Both shootings happened in Yonkers, with one occurring on Friday, Jan. 20 on Saint Joseph Avenue, and one occurring on Tuesday, Jan. 24 on Beaumont Circle, according to Yonkers Police.  Both shootings left victims with non-life-threatening injuries.  After a couple of days, 30-year-old Deiandre Phillips was charged in the Saint Joseph Avenue shooting, and 44-year-old Ricky Towns was charged in the Beaumont Circle shooting.
